I'm a Civil Air Patrol member. I'm also a software engineer who builds AI tools for civic problems through Fresh Sky LLC. CAP eats so much volunteer time on admin — looking up the right CAPR section, prepping cadets for AT cycles, building meeting agendas — that I built free tools to take the worst of it off your plate.

Three apps live now: CAPR Search answers regulation questions in plain language with citations · CAPStudy generates Achievement Test practice questions for cadets across the Curry through Eaker progression · CAPMeeting builds a 90-minute squadron meeting agenda with safety briefing, AE moment, and drill plan from a few inputs.

All three are free for CAP members and squadrons. No contracts. No upsell. No PII. No member roster uploads. The only thing you give it is the question or the inputs you'd be typing anyway. The reason I can do this for free: operator-side cost is near-zero on Cloud Run with scale-to-zero, and I'm not charging for my time.

CAPR Search Live Every member

Plain-language Q&A over CAP regulations and pamphlets. Ask "what does CAPR 60-3 say about cadet supervision?" — get an answer with the regulation cited. Public-domain content; verify current versions on capmembers.com.

CAPStudy Live Cadets

Achievement Test practice generator. Pick your current achievement (Curry → Mitchell → Eaker), get instant practice questions with explanations. Covers Leadership Lab + Aerospace Education topics for the entire cadet program.

CAPMeeting Live Squadron commanders

Weekly squadron meeting agenda builder. Tell it your meeting date, who's attending, and current focus area — get a complete 90-minute agenda with safety briefing, AE moment, drill plan, and time blocks.
